Symbiobacterium thermophilum is a syntrophic bacterium whose growth depends on coculture with a cognate Bacillus sp. We have been studying the unique features of S. thermophilum in terms of taxonomy, ecology, genome biology, and physiology. Here we overview current knowledge of this bacterium. Extremely thermophilic bacteria and archaea (Topt≥70°C) inhabit thermal biotopes that are distributed globally in both terrestrial and marine settings. … the cowmen lyricsWebb20 maj 2024 · The suffix -phile comes from the Greek philos, which means to love. Words that end with (-phile) refer to someone or something that loves or has a fondness of, attraction to, or affection for something. It also means to have a tendency toward something.
